Description Hans de Goede 2012-09-02 14:06:35 UTC
Hi,

I've just upgraded to F-18, and I've noticed the following messages in dmesg when running in permissive mode:

[    9.653558] type=1400 audit(1346591517.058:3): avc:  denied  { mmap_zero } for  pid=381 comm="vbetool" scontext=system_u:system_r:vbetool_t:s0-s0:c0.c1023 tcontext=system_u:system_r:vbetool_t:s0-s0:c0.c1023 tclass=memprotect
[    9.654192] type=1400 audit(1346591517.059:4): avc:  denied  { secure_firmware } for  pid=381 comm="vbetool" capability=37  scontext=system_u:system_r:vbetool_t:s0-s0:c0.c1023 tcontext=system_u:system_r:vbetool_t:s0-s0:c0.c1023 tclass=capability2

Some notes:
1) auditd is not yet running at this time as vbetool runs from a udev rule in the initrd (or so I believe)
2) Since I only had vbetool for historical reasons I've simply done "rpm -e vbetool" :)

Comment 1 Miroslav Grepl 2012-09-03 09:08:14 UTC
[    9.653558] type=1400 audit(1346591517.058:3): avc:  denied  { mmap_zero } for  pid=381 comm="vbetool" scontext=system_u:system_r:vbetool_t:s0-s0:c0.c1023 tcontext=system_u:system_r:vbetool_t:s0-s0:c0.c1023 tclass=memprote

can be allowed by mmap_low_allowed.

I added a rule for secure_firmware
